Cleansing and Unclogging Nozzles



When dealing with typical lawn sprinkler issues, resolving blockages is important for maintaining optimum system performance. With time, particles such as dirt, turf cuttings, and mineral down payments can gather within the nozzles, blocking water flow and decreasing irrigation effectiveness. To ensure your lawn sprinklers run properly, normal cleansing and unclogging of nozzles is essential.


Begin by transforming off the watering system to stop any unexpected water discharge. Meticulously eliminate the nozzle from the lawn sprinkler head. For comprehensive cleaning, soak the nozzle in a blend of water and vinegar or a commercial cleaning remedy made to dissolve mineral deposits.


Rinse the nozzle under running water to remove any kind of continuing to be debris and reattach it to the sprinkler head. Transform the system back on and observe the water distribution to guarantee the blockage has actually been removed. Regular upkeep of sprinkler nozzles can considerably boost the long life and performance of your watering system.


Replacing Broken Lawn Sprinkler Heads



Changing broken lawn sprinkler heads is a critical action in preserving a reliable irrigation system. When a lawn sprinkler head ends up being damaged, it can cause water wastefulness and irregular coverage, which can detrimentally impact the wellness of your yard or yard. The very first action is to determine the defective head, usually evident with uneven water spray patterns or water pooling around the base.


Begin by switching off the water supply to stop any type of unneeded splilling. Use a shovel to meticulously dig around the lawn sprinkler head, ensuring you do not harm the surrounding piping. When revealed, unscrew the damaged head from the riser, keeping in mind of the make and model to guarantee you acquire a compatible replacement.


Following, clean the threads on the riser to eliminate any type of dirt or particles that could prevent a proper seal. Screw the brand-new sprinkler head onto the riser by hand, guaranteeing it is tight but not excessively limited to stay clear of damaging the threads. Re-fill the hole with soil, packing it down securely to remove air pockets. Transform the water supply back on and evaluate the brand-new head to guarantee it is operating appropriately, making changes as necessary.


Adjusting Water Stress and Coverage



In order to optimize the performance of your watering system, readjusting water stress and protection is important. Correct water stress makes certain that each lawn sprinkler head runs effectively, distributing water evenly throughout your lawn or garden. To begin, gauge the water stress at the primary supply line using a stress scale. Ideal pressure commonly varies from 30 to 50 psi. If the stress is too expensive, think about installing a stress regulatory authority to stop damage to sprinkler heads and pipelines.


Following, concentrate on changing lawn sprinkler head insurance coverage to remove completely dry areas and overwatered areas. For rotary heads, readjust the arc and span setups utilizing a screwdriver to modify the instructions and distance of water flow.


Ensure overlapping protection between surrounding sprinkler heads to stay clear of missed areas.
